To … key snapped in door lockWeb2 de jul. de 2024 · Open Excel then open the TXT file with excel click through the boxes saying next until it finishes transferring data You will then be able to save as a excel sheet MIXTRADER1 2024-01-02 17:11:32 UTC #6 When copy & paste into a spreadsheet only one column with all content is available MIXTRADER1 2024-01-02 17:15:08 UTC #7 key snapped in padlockWebMicrosoft Excel has the ability to open tab-delimited files and display them as spreadsheets. However, tab-delimited files have the extension TXT. Therefore, a tab-delimited file will open in Notepad rather than Excel when you double-click it. Instead of double-clicking a tab-delimited file, launch Excel first and open the file from within Excel. keysnorth propertiesWeb13 de abr. de 2024 · Existem opções de conversão online, mas dependem do formato do arquivo TXT que você possui.
